Role of random blood glucose and HbA1c levels in optimizing glucose tolerance screening in early pregnancy: a retrospective cohort study.

Abstract

OBJECTIVE

Random blood glucose (rBG) levels are commonly measured in Japan; however, no standardized cutoff values exist for glucose tolerance screening in early pregnancy. The contribution of glycated hemoglobin (HbA1c) and glycated albumin (GA) measurements to the diagnosis of gestational diabetes mellitus (GDM) remains unclear. Therefore, we aimed to evaluate the significance of these glycemic indicators in early pregnancy for predicting GDM.

METHODS

This observational cohort study enrolled pregnant women who underwent initial prenatal examinations to determine their rBG, HbA1c, and GA levels at a rural maternity facility. Clinical data were retrospectively reviewed.

RESULTS

A total of 449 patients were analyzed, comprising 394 with normal glucose tolerance (NGT) and 55 with GDM. The rBG, HbA1c, and GA levels were significantly higher during early pregnancy in women who developed GDM than in those with NGT. Receiver operating characteristic curve analysis revealed that the areas under the curve (AUC) for rBG, HbA1c, and GA were 0.733, 0.591, and 0.608, respectively, with cutoff values of 100 mg/dL, 5.2%, and 14.6%, respectively. These cutoff values had sensitivities of 52.7%, 70.9%, and 36.4% and specificities of 87.6%, 43.4%, and 82.5%, respectively. The product of rBG and HbA1c levels demonstrated improved performance, with an AUC of 0.750, cutoff value of 509, 63.6% sensitivity, and 83.5% specificity.

CONCLUSION

Glucose tolerance screening in early pregnancy using an rBG level of 100 mg/dL and an HbA1c level of 5.2% as cutoff values may help identify high-risk cases and enable early diagnosis of GDM.

摘要

目的

在日本,随机血糖(rBG)水平通常会被检测;然而,早期妊娠糖耐量筛查尚无标准化的临界值。糖化血红蛋白(HbA1c)和糖化白蛋白(GA)检测对妊娠期糖尿病(GDM)诊断的贡献仍不明确。因此,我们旨在评估这些血糖指标在早期妊娠中对预测GDM的意义。

方法

这项观察性队列研究纳入了在一家农村产科机构接受首次产前检查以测定其rBG、HbA1c和GA水平的孕妇。对临床数据进行回顾性分析。

结果

共分析了449例患者,其中394例糖耐量正常(NGT),55例患有GDM。发生GDM的女性在妊娠早期的rBG、HbA1c和GA水平显著高于NGT女性。受试者工作特征曲线分析显示,rBG、HbA1c和GA的曲线下面积(AUC)分别为0.733、0.591和0.608,临界值分别为100mg/dL、5.2%和14.6%。这些临界值的敏感度分别为52.7%、70.9%和36.4%,特异度分别为87.6%、43.4%和82.5%。rBG和HbA1c水平的乘积显示出更好的性能,AUC为0.750,临界值为509,敏感度为63.6%,特异度为83.5%。

结论

以100mg/dL的rBG水平和5.2%的HbA1c水平作为临界值进行早期妊娠糖耐量筛查,可能有助于识别高危病例并实现GDM的早期诊断。
